[Design question] What's your opinion on prestige? by Sjonegaard in incremental_games

[–]Imusje 8 points9 points  (0 children)

A prestige system can work if it lets you appreciate either how much better you have become or which effects your choices have during a run. It should never feel like "just do the same thing but 5% faster" but actually make a difference.

It could be that you inherit most of the tools of your parents as well as the best starting seeds they created to make the start meaningfully faster.

You can restart on a bigger plot of land or a different kind of soil that unlocks a different kind of krop. Maybe even let the "old farm" keep generating some income or seeds or some products that you might still need.

Most importantly, any reset should naratively feel like it makes sense in your game, not just a "here is a wall that you can only pass by starting over for no reason other than more gameplay hours".

My friend just started playing. I have to hold back and let him explore. 4x Green Science production at 3 Locations by [deleted] in Factoriohno

[–]Imusje 87 points88 points  (0 children)

Good on you for "letting him explore". It takes patience to let people learn.

Also consider the following: "make it exist first, you can make it better later". Those 4 green science machines can continue to chug along research while your friend figures out what to do next. There is no need yet for faster/cleaner builds at this stage.

Bonus tip: since it's over producing inserters and belts to make those science packs you can steal some of those and put them in a (limited!) chest so your friend can just pick them up when he figures out upscaling production.

Rubik's cube magic, i can't process by kvjn100 in blackmagicfuckery

[–]Imusje 1 point2 points  (0 children)

If you go frame by frame you can see he does 4 moves. The first really slow. Then the next 2 (top and bottom layer) together in 1 or 2 frames (so insanely fast) and the last double move in another few frames (still really fast but you can still notice this move happening).

The amazing thing is that 2 frame move in the middle that allows to make the cube "look" scrambled at the start.

So no defying physics, just too fast for human eyes like all great magic.

How can I solve the trucks queueing on same spot? by dvdmcwilliams in openttd

[–]Imusje 11 points12 points  (0 children)

With stations touching the first truck goes to the end of the platform, next one stands still behind it and stays there when first one leaves, then next one stops behind that one one too. But once you reach the backend it resets and the next one goes all the way to the front again. Should be good enough,but if you want more throughput add a parallel station as well so trucks have a second free path available to a front of the station when another is standing still

Incremental games with a a time limit for each prestige cycle? by ObamaIsPutin in incremental_games

[–]Imusje 0 points1 point  (0 children)

It mostly depends on what you get out of the reincarnation. If it's only a minor increase of say 5% faster progress then 72h sounds like a lot. If you open up different paths/options to change your loop each time then it could work if your loop itself is engaging enough to want to replay for days on end.

If you take increlution as an example then the loops itself are always 30 to 45 minutes giving minor increments. And the DNA after completion a 2% increase afterwards. The DNA itself wouldn't keep players hooked by itself, it's only good because the main game is engaging enough that people want "more of the same" and have the reset option with minor rewards in current form as a way to wait for more content then it is the main mechanic.

After a couple of replays a run under 7 days so getting closer to your 72h goal, really high grinders even got down to under 24 hours. And there are people with thousands of hours logged that way, so it's definitely possible to make it work.

My main concern would be that you should choose if your game wants to be idle or active and design the game around that. Doing a bit of both not well thought out means you lose both types of players.

Is there a way for bus to automaticaly go to every bus station in a city and add the new one in the loop? by wakkys in openttd

[–]Imusje 1 point2 points  (0 children)

Adding to say just clicking clones the current orders but does not share. Ctrl click makes it shared.

For OP's use case you want shared orders so all busses update their route if you change one later with a new stop.
